#962838 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#962838 is composed of 58.8% red, 15.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 351.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 37.3%. #962838 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5070 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#962838 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#962838 has RGB values of R:150, G:40,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.63,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9840696.

Shades and Tints of #962838
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0304 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#962838
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635b5c is the less saturated color, while #bb031e is the most saturated one.
